Output 1f55500cfcd813b940726b59c19369a18d5e89924e5c9ec3efb93ad6bfc29ff5:5

value
17634814
script pubkey
OP_0 OP_PUSHBYTES_20 8e03f11609e8859a1e8da841092c951a86c20658
address
bc1q3cplz9sfazze585d4pqsjty4r2rvypjcya22nl
transaction
1f55500cfcd813b940726b59c19369a18d5e89924e5c9ec3efb93ad6bfc29ff5